Despite first loss, Soul retains top spot
PHILADELPHIA TOPS SCHUTT
SPORTS AFL TOP 12 POLL

LAS VEGAS (AFLWA) – It will take more than one loss to knock the Philadelphia Soul from the top spot in the Schutt Sports Top 12 Poll.

Schutt SportsDespite losing to No. 6 Cleveland last Friday after just four days of rest, the Soul garnered all but three first-place votes of members of the Arena Football League Writers Association. It was Philadelphia’s first regular-season loss since June 9, when it fell 69-59 at Tampa Bay.

The Gladiators jumped over idle New York by knocking off the top-ranked team. It is the highest they have been ranked since being sixth in Week 6. Cleveland started the season 3-0 and climbed as high as third.

No. 2 Dallas (2) and No. 3 Chicago (1) shared the other first-place votes. The Desperados squeaked by Columbus 48-45, and the Rush topped Tampa Bay, which fell out of the poll, 61-46 on Monday night.

Other than Cleveland, there were four teams who moved up this week. Orlando jumped from sixth to fourth by crushing No. 8 San Jose 61-35. No. 9 Colorado and No. 10 Georgia were tied in last week’s poll at 11th and both won, as the Crush routed Grand Rapids 63-28 and the Force stopped No. 5 New Orleans, which dropped one spot, 66-39. Also, Los Angeles re-entered the poll after defeating No. 11 Arizona 66-59.

The AFLWA, founded at the start of the 2004 season, is a national organization made up of media members who cover the Arena Football League. Mark Anderson of the Las Vegas Review-Journal is the AFLWA's founder and executive director.
